Holiday Pork Meatballs (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

01 - 2 large eggs.
02 - A third of a cup of ketchup.
03 - Half a teaspoon each of salt and black pepper.
04 - One and a half pounds of ground pork.
05 - One tiny onion, grated finely.
06 - A cup of panko-style breadcrumbs.
07 - Two spoonfuls of Worcestershire sauce.
08 - A quarter cup of freshly chopped parsley.
09 - Two cups of cranberry sauce for the glaze.
10 - A full cup of ketchup, used to make the glaze.
11 - Three tablespoons of brown sugar, packed.
12 - A single tablespoon of lemon juice.

# Instructions:

01 - Set your oven to 350°F. Put baking paper on a tray.
02 - Throw all the meatball ingredients together, then shape into 32 balls.
03 - Pop meatballs in oven for 20-25 minutes until the insides hit 160°F.
04 - Heat cranberry mix with ketchup, sugar, and lemon juice till bubbly.
05 - Toss meatballs into the warm sauce. Mix until they're coated and heated through.

# Notes:

01 - You can make this 48 hours in advance.
